    Understanding Pizza Hut Singapore's Delivery Fees

    Let's get straight to the point: delivery fees. At Pizza Hut Singapore, the delivery fee can vary depending on several factors. Typically, you'll find that the delivery fee is influenced by your order's total amount and the delivery location. Sometimes, there might be promotional periods or special offers that waive the delivery fee altogether, so it's always a good idea to keep an eye out for those deals! Generally, expect a delivery fee ranging from $4 to $7 for orders below a certain threshold, usually around $15 to $20. If your order exceeds this amount, you might qualify for free delivery.

    To be absolutely sure about the delivery fee for your specific order, the best practice is to check directly on the Pizza Hut Singapore website or app before finalizing your purchase. This way, you'll get the most accurate information based on your location and the current promotions. Also, keep in mind that during peak hours, such as weekends or public holidays, delivery fees might be slightly higher or there could be a minimum order requirement.     Factors Influencing Delivery Fees

    Several factors play a role in determining the delivery fee you’ll encounter when ordering from Pizza Hut Singapore. Understanding these elements can help you strategize your orders and potentially save on those extra charges.

    1. Order Amount: Often, Pizza Hut sets a minimum order amount to qualify for free delivery. If your order exceeds this amount, you won’t have to pay a delivery fee. So, gather your friends or family and make a bulk order to reach that threshold!
    2. Location: The distance between your delivery address and the nearest Pizza Hut outlet can affect the delivery fee. Addresses further away might incur higher charges due to increased transportation costs.
    3. Promotions: Keep an eye out for promotional periods or special offers that waive delivery fees. Pizza Hut frequently runs promotions, especially during holidays or special events, that can significantly reduce or eliminate delivery charges.
    4. Peak Hours: During peak hours, such as lunch and dinner times, weekends, and public holidays, delivery fees might be higher. Demand is high during these times, and Pizza Hut might adjust their fees accordingly.
    5. Platform: Sometimes, the platform you use to place your order (website vs. app) can have different promotional offers or delivery fee structures. It’s a good idea to check both to see which offers the best deal.
